Understanding the Solar Inverter Hybrid 10kW A Comprehensive Guide


As the world increasingly seeks sustainable energy solutions, solar power has emerged as one of the most promising options for both residential and commercial use. Among the various solar technologies, the solar inverter hybrid 10kW stands out as an exceptional choice for those looking to optimize their energy usage. This article will delve into the functionality, benefits, and considerations of the solar inverter hybrid 10kW, providing a comprehensive understanding of its importance in modern energy systems.


What is a Solar Inverter Hybrid 10kW?


A solar inverter hybrid system is a vital component in a solar power setup, converting direct current (DC) generated by solar panels into alternating current (AC), which is used by most household appliances. The term 'hybrid' indicates that this system can manage various sources of energy, including solar panels, battery storage, and, in some cases, the grid electricity. The 10kW specification refers to the system's capacity to handle a maximum output of 10 kilowatts of power, making it suitable for medium to large-sized households or commercial establishments.


Key Features


1. Energy Management The solar inverter hybrid 10kW is equipped with advanced energy management capabilities. It intelligently prioritizes solar energy use, ensuring that the excess energy produced during the day can be stored in batteries for later use, effectively reducing reliance on the grid during peak hours.


2. Battery Compatibility One of the standout features of a hybrid inverter is its ability to work with battery storage systems. This compatibility allows homeowners to store energy for use during the night or during periods of low solar generation, enhancing overall energy independence.


3. Grid Support Many hybrid solar inverters come with grid support functionality, which allows them to feed excess energy back into the grid. This not only helps regulate the grid but also enables users to benefit from net metering, earning credits for the energy contributed to the public utility.


4. Robust Monitoring Systems Modern hybrid inverters often have integrated monitoring systems. Users can track energy usage, solar generation, and battery status through mobile applications or web interfaces, ensuring transparency and ease of management.


Benefits


1. Energy Independence By harnessing solar energy and utilizing battery storage, homeowners can significantly reduce their dependence on the grid. This independence becomes particularly valuable during power outages or electricity rate hikes.

2. Cost Savings Investing in a solar inverter hybrid system can lead to substantial long-term savings on electricity bills. With the capacity to store energy and use it efficiently, homeowners can mitigate costs associated with peak electricity rates.


3. Environmental Impact Transitioning to solar energy with a hybrid inverter reduces carbon emissions, contributing to a cleaner environment. As awareness of climate change continues to grow, more individuals and businesses are opting for renewable energy solutions to mitigate their carbon footprints.


4. Versatility The hybrid inverter system can adapt to varying energy needs. Whether for a residential property, an office, or even an industrial application, the 10kW capacity offers flexibility to cater to different energy requirements.


Considerations


While solar inverter hybrid systems provide numerous advantages, certain factors should be taken into account


1. Initial Investment The upfront cost for installing a solar inverter hybrid system can be significant. However, various financing options, government incentives, and tax rebates can help offset these costs.


2. Space Requirements Depending on the type and number of solar panels and battery storage units needed, adequate space is necessary for installation.


3. Maintenance Like any technology, hybrid solar inverters require regular maintenance to ensure optimal performance. Keeping the system well-maintained can extend its lifespan and improve efficiency.
